Running one-off .NET tools with dnx: Exploring the .NET 10 preview - Part 5

Read Original

This article details the new `dnx` command introduced in the .NET 10 preview, which allows developers to run one-off .NET tools directly from NuGet packages without a prior installation step. It explains the command's usage, syntax, and how it compares to existing `dotnet tool` commands and similar tools like npx in the Node.js ecosystem.
